Are Oedipus Rex and Oedipus the King the same story?
Yes. They are indeed the same story. The story of Oedipus is a well - known Greek tragedy. Whether it is called 'Oedipus Rex' (which is in Latin) or 'Oedipus the King' (in English), it tells the same tale of fate, prophecy, and self - discovery. Oedipus tries to escape his fate but ends up fulfilling the prophecy in a very tragic way.

What is the story of Oedipus the King?
Oedipus the King is a classic Greek tragedy. It's about a man who unknowingly kills his father and marries his mother, fulfilling a prophecy. It explores themes of fate, free will, and the search for truth.

What is the theme of the story 'Oedipus the King'?
One of the key themes in 'Oedipus the King' is the power of prophecy and the consequences of defying it. Oedipus' attempts to avoid his foretold destiny only lead to his downfall, showing the inescapable nature of fate as predicted by the oracles.

Why is the story of King Oedipus a tragedy?
The tale of King Oedipus is tragic for several reasons. Firstly, his ignorance of his true identity leads to unforeseen and disastrous consequences. Secondly, the irreversible nature of his actions and the inescapable downfall add to the tragic element. Finally, the themes of hubris and the limits of human knowledge are prevalent throughout the story.

How is the story of Oedipus the King ironic?
The story is ironic because Oedipus tries to avoid his fate but ends up fulfilling it exactly. He unknowingly kills his father and marries his mother, despite all his efforts to prevent such a tragic outcome.
